Average Cabinetmakers and Bench Carpenters Salary in West Montana nonmetropolitan area

Cabinetmakers and Bench Carpenters in the West Montana nonmetropolitan area earn an average annual salary of $47,890. This figure is slightly above the national average of $47,380, suggesting a localized demand that slightly outpaces national compensation trends. Cabinetmakers and Bench Carpenters Salary Distribution in West Montana nonmetropolitan area

The salary trajectory for Cabinetmakers and Bench Carpenters typically scales with experience. Entry-level positions often start at the lower percentiles, while seasoned professionals with extensive portfolios and specialized skills can command salaries in the upper percentiles. The significant gaps between these percentiles highlight the substantial career progression and earning potential available to those who develop their expertise and build a strong reputation in the field.

Experience LevelMarket PercentileAnnual WageHourly Rate
ApprenticeLearning trade under supervision. Classroom + OJT.10% (Entry)$33,560$16.1
JourneymanLicensed/Certified. Works independently on standard tasks.25% (Junior)$35,918$17.3
Senior TechnicianHandles complex installations & troubleshooting.50% (Median)$46,960$22.6
Foreman / MasterSupervises crews, handles permits & code compliance.75% (Senior)$59,863$28.8
SuperintendentSite management, business owner, or master tradesman.90% (Expert)$62,780$30.2

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 210 employees in the West Montana nonmetropolitan area area with a job density of 2.523 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
